Dalmatia is the southern region of Croatia. On the Adriatic coast, the climate is Mediterranean, but in the northern part, where winter is quite cold and summer remains quite rainy, it can be described as . The rainfall pattern is Mediterranean along the coast, with a minimum in summer and a maximum in autumn and winter, while in the interior plains, precipitation is frequent throughout the year, and in winter, it often occurs in the form of snow, but it's more abundant in summer, when it often occurs in the form of thunderstorms. Croatia is moderately rainy in the plains and inland valleys, and definitely rainy along the coast and the western slopes of the mountain ranges.
